staging: lustre: obdclass: llog: drop trivially useless initialization

Author: Julia Lawall <Julia.Lawall@lip6.fr>

Remove initialization of a variable that is immediately reassigned.

The semantic patch that makes this change is as follows:
(http://coccinelle.lip6.fr/)

// 
@@
type T;
identifier x;
constant C;
expression e;
@@

T x
- = C
 ;
x = e;
//
